Output 37346ce82e361cda2fcb077a4622399160ab1fcb6b3edbe2f61cb7ed16924126:0

value
2597895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b972e32a50c82f83ae1425a1c673a004ccf105 OP_EQUAL
address
39sSDpjBx8LUs5ZgaRmY343XAE9nxbZyTq
transaction
37346ce82e361cda2fcb077a4622399160ab1fcb6b3edbe2f61cb7ed16924126
spent
true